## Trust model
|
||||||
|
|
||||||
|
There are two categories of users of the Lix daemon: trusted users and untrusted users.
|
||||||
|
The Lix daemon only allows connections from users that are either trusted users, or are specified in, or are members of groups specified in, [`allowed-users`](../command-ref/conf-file.md#conf-allowed-users) in `nix.conf`.
|
||||||
|
Trusted users are users and users of groups specified in [`trusted-users`](../command-ref/conf-file.md#conf-trusted-users) in `nix.conf`.
|
||||||
|
|
||||||
|
All users of the Lix daemon may do the following to bring things into the Nix store:
|
||||||
|
|
||||||
|
- Users may load derivations and output-addressed files into the store with `nix-store --add` or through Nix language code.
|
||||||
|
- Users may locally build derivations, either of the output-addressed or input-addressed variety, creating output paths.
|
||||||
|
|
||||||
|
Note that [fixed-output derivations only consider name and hash](https://github.com/NixOS/nix/issues/969), so it is possible to write a fixed-output derivation for something important with a bogus hash and have it resolve to something else already built in the store.
|
||||||
|
|
||||||
|
On systems with `sandbox` enabled (default on Linux; [not *yet* on macOS][sandbox-enable-macos]), derivations are either:
|
||||||
|
- Input-addressed, so they are run in the sandbox with no network access, with the following exceptions:
|
||||||
|
|
||||||
|
- The (poorly named, since it is not *just* about chroot) property `__noChroot` is set on the derivation and `sandbox` is set to `relaxed`.
|
||||||
|
- On macOS, the derivation property `__darwinAllowLocalNetworking` allows network access to localhost from input-addressed derivations regardless of the `sandbox` setting value. This property exists with such semantics because macOS has no network namespace equivalent to isolate individual processes' localhost networking.
|
||||||
|
- Output-addressed, so they are run with network access but their result must match an expected hash.
|
||||||
|
|
||||||
|
Trusted users may set any setting, including `sandbox = false`, so the sandbox state can be different at runtime from what is described in `nix.conf` for builds invoked with such settings.
|
||||||
|
- Users may copy appropriately-signed derivation outputs into the store.
|
||||||
|
|
||||||
|
By default, any paths *copied into a store* (such as by substitution) must have signatures from [`trusted-public-keys`](../command-ref/conf-file.md#conf-trusted-public-keys) unless they are [output-addressed](../glossary.md#gloss-output-addressed-store-object).
|
||||||
|
|
||||||
|
Unsigned paths may be copied into a store if [`require-sigs`](../command-ref/conf-file.md#conf-require-sigs) is disabled in the daemon's configuration (not default), or if the client is a trusted user and passed `--no-check-sigs` to `nix copy`.
|
||||||
|
- Users may request that the daemon substitutes appropriately-signed derivation outputs from a binary cache in the daemon's [`substituters`](../command-ref/conf-file.md#conf-substituters) list.
|
||||||
|
|
||||||
|
Untrusted clients may also specify additional values for `substituters` (via e.g. `--extra-substituters` on a Nix command) that are listed in [`trusted-substituters`](../command-ref/conf-file.md#conf-trusted-substituters).
|
||||||
|
|
||||||
|
A client could in principle substitute such paths itself then copy them to the daemon (see clause above) if they are appropriately signed but are *not* from a trusted substituter, however this is not implemented in the current Lix client to our knowledge, at the time of writing.
|
||||||
|
This probably means that `trusted-substituters` is a redundant setting except insofar as such substitution would have to be done on the client rather than as root on the daemon; and it is highly defensible to not allow random usage of our HTTP client running as root.
|

### The Lix daemon as a security non-boundary
|
||||||
|
|
||||||
|
The Lix team and wider community does not consider the Lix daemon to be a *security boundary* against malicious Nix language code.
|
||||||
|
|
||||||
|
Although we do our best to make it secure, we do not recommend sharing a Lix daemon with potentially malicious users.
|
||||||
|
That means that public continuous integration (CI) builds of untrusted Nix code should not share builders with CI that writes into a cache used by trusted infrastructure.
|
||||||
|
|
||||||
|
For example, [hydra.nixos.org], which is the builder for [cache.nixos.org], does not execute untrusted Nix language code; a separate system, [ofborg] is used for CI of nixpkgs pull requests.
|
||||||
|
The build output of pull request CI is never pushed to [cache.nixos.org], and those systems are considered entirely untrusted.
|
||||||
|
|
||||||
|
This is because, among other things, the Lix sandbox is *more* susceptible to kernel exploits than Docker, which, unlike Lix, blocks nested user namespaces via `seccomp` in its default policy, and there have been many kernel bugs only exposed to unprivileged users via user namespaces allowing otherwise-root-only system calls.
|
||||||
|
In general, the Lix sandbox is set up to be relatively unrestricted while maintaining its goals of building useful, reproducible software; security is not its primary goal.
|
||||||
|
|
||||||
|
The Lix sandbox is a custom *non-rootless* Linux container implementation that has not been audited to nearly the same degree as Docker and similar systems.
|
||||||
|
Also, the Lix daemon is a complex and historied C++ executable running as root with very little privilege separation.
|
||||||
|
All of this means that a security hole in the Lix daemon gives immediate root access.
|
||||||
|
Systems like Docker (especially non-rootless Docker) should *themselves* probably not be used in a multi-tenant manner with mutually distrusting tenants, but the Lix daemon *especially* should not be used as such as of this writing.
|
||||||
|
|
||||||
|
The primary purpose of the sandbox is to strongly encourage packages to be reproducible, a goal which it is generally quite successful at.

### Trusted users
|
||||||
|
|
||||||
|
Trusted users are permitted to set any setting and bypass security restrictions on the daemon.
|
||||||
|
They are currently in widespread use for a couple of reasons such as remote builds (which we [intend to fix](https://git.lix.systems/lix-project/lix/issues/171)).
|
||||||
|
|
||||||
|
Trusted users are effectively root on Nix daemons running as root (the default configuration) for *at least* the following reasons, and should be thus thought of as equivalent to passwordless sudo.
|
||||||
|
This is not a comprehensive list.
|
||||||
|
|
||||||
|
- They may copy an unsigned malicious built output into the store for `systemd` or anything else that will run as root, then when the system is upgraded, that path will be used from the local store rather than substituted.
|
||||||
|
- They may set the following settings that are commands the daemon will run as root:
|
||||||
|
- `build-hook`
|
||||||
|
- `diff-hook`
|
||||||
|
- `pre-build-hook`
|
||||||
|
- `post-build-hook`
|
||||||
|
- They may set `build-users-group`.
|
||||||
|
|
||||||
|
In particular, they may set it to empty string, which runs builds as root with respect to the rest of the system (!!).
|
||||||
|
We, too, [think that is absurd and intend to not accept such a configuration](https://git.lix.systems/lix-project/lix/issues/242).
|
||||||
|
It is then simply an exercise to the reader to find a daemon that does `SCM_CREDENTIALS` over a `unix(7)` socket and lets you run commands as root, and mount it into the sandbox with `extra-sandbox-paths`.
|
||||||
|
|
||||||
|
At the very least, the Lix daemon itself (since `root` is a trusted user by default) and probably `systemd` qualify for this.
|
||||||
|
- They may set the `builders` list, which will have ssh run as root.
|
||||||
|
We aren't sure if there is a way to abuse this for command execution but it's plausible.
|
||||||
|
|
||||||
|
Note that setting `accept-flake-config` allows arbitrary Nix flakes to set Nix settings in the `nixConfig` stanza.
|
||||||
|
Do not set this setting or pass `--accept-flake-config` while executing untrusted Nix language code as a trusted user for the reasons above!
